- 1cup Apple
- 1/2cup Caramel Sauce
- 1/2cup Chocolate Sauce
- 1/4cup Chocolate Chips
-
Wash and core the apples, slice into very thin pieces.
-
Arrange the apple slices on a plate, pour the caramel and chocolate sauce over it. Sprinkle the chocolate chips over it.
-
Chill for 10 mins, serve with a caramel sauce as a dip
